The studio units were delivered to the Amaala Staff Village.

Group Amana, a leading design and build company in the Middle East, has set a new benchmark in offsite construction, with the delivery of Red Sea Global’s Amaala Staff Village, where it effectively combined digital innovation, offsite efficiency, and environmental stewardship.

Amaala is an ultra-luxury tourism destination under development along Saudi Arabia’s Red Sea coast. Spanning 4,000 sq km, the project embodies the kingdom’s vision for innovation, sustainability, and cultural preservation. 

Designed to offer bespoke wellness and lifestyle experiences amid pristine natural landscapes, Amaala will welcome guests to nine distinctive resorts, delivered in partnership with renowned brands such as Clinique La Prairie, Equinox, and Four Seasons. 

Once completed, the destination will redefine high-end sustainable tourism and position Saudi Arabia as a global leader in luxury travel. 

The Staff Village, set within Amaala, underscores Amana’s high standards in modular construction, safety, and timely completion using revolutionary techniques by DuBox. 

The leading design and build company said more than 1,404 modular concrete studio units were manufactured offsite and installed across 27 buildings, resulting in 30 per cent reduction in construction time and 35 per cent reduction in on-site manpower.
